1. Backlight leakage or backlight bleed can be expierenced with a dark image or completly black screen. The symptoms are "non black" areas or the screen isnt uniformly the same black color. This is caused by the fact that the backlight is still on full blast even thought the pixels are told to shut down and not let light escape... some light still comes through.

2. Buzzing problems expierenced with lcds is commonly caused by the circuit that takes the low voltage input source and steps it up to super high voltage to run the cold cathode. Or within that same circuit the Pulse width modulation used to determine the backlight brightness.

4. Input lag ust to be a big problem with lcds back in the day... nowadays your typical lcd doesnt as much but it will always be there... usually ranges from 15-60ms... but like i said newer lcds are getting better and better.

For example... my 52inch LCD HDTV has a claimed 8ms Responce time from white to black... and its definetly 8ms as the display is able to do 120hz refresh... but thats a whole nother subject. ANYWAYS i tested the lag of the screen by simply hooking a CRT monitor to my htpc then ran cloned displays with a timer that had 1/1000th's of seconds. Then using a digi camera with flash on i captured many images. (just so you know computer monitors have a decent amount lower of input lag as HDTV's usually do a bit more of image processing before displaying the image)

Crt is on left HDTV is on right... ~ a 44ms lag in this picture... but it ranged from 29ms - 44ms lag and averaged out to 38.8ms using 10 different pictures.
